Perfect Parries: The Art of the Counter-Strike

A Perfect Parry is more than just blocking an attack; it's a precisely timed deflection that leaves your enemy vulnerable. Mastering this technique is crucial for controlling the battlefield and maximizing your damage output.

  • How to Perform: To execute a Perfect Parry, you must swing your weapon to meet an incoming enemy attack just as it is about to connect. The timing is tight, often requiring you to anticipate the enemy's strike rather than react to it. You'll know you've succeeded by a distinct sound cue, a visual flash, and the enemy being momentarily stunned.
  • Benefits:
    • Extended Stun Duration: Unlike a regular parry, a Perfect Parry stuns most enemies for a significantly longer period, creating a substantial window for follow-up attacks.
    • Critical Opening: During the stun, many enemies expose weak points or become susceptible to critical hits, allowing you to deal massive damage.
    • Stamina Regeneration: Successfully landing a Perfect Parry often grants a small burst of stamina, allowing you to maintain offensive pressure.
    • Momentum Generation: Perfect Parries contribute significantly to your combat momentum, helping to charge your Divine Powers faster.
  • Strategic Application:
    • Against Brutes: Enemies like the Garmr Brute in the Desert of Souls often have slow, telegraphed attacks that are ideal for practicing Perfect Parries. A successful parry can stun them, allowing you to target their exposed back or head.
    • Against Fast Attackers: While more challenging, Perfect Parrying fast enemies like the Desert Scorpions can break their aggressive combos and create openings.
    • Boss Encounters: Many boss attacks, such as Anubis's sweeping scythe attacks, can be Perfect Parried to interrupt their phases or create brief windows for high-damage abilities.
  • Common Pitfall: Don't spam parries. Focus on learning enemy attack patterns. Mistiming a Perfect Parry often results in taking full damage or a regular block, which doesn't offer the same benefits.

Follower Combos: Unleash Synergistic Devastation

Your followers are more than just companions; they are extensions of your combat prowess. Learning to chain their abilities with your own attacks can lead to devastating, crowd-controlling, or highly damaging combos.

  • Understanding Follower Abilities: Each follower possesses unique abilities that can be activated in combat. For example:
    • Trax: Can create an area-of-effect stun or pull enemies together.
    • Sayla: Offers ranged support, often applying status effects or dealing focused damage.
    • Dellingr: Provides defensive buffs or can draw enemy aggro.
  • Executing Combos:
    • Stun & Smash: Have Trax use his Ground Stomp ability to stun a group of enemies. Immediately follow up with a heavy area-of-effect attack from your hammer or a wide sweep with your sword. This is particularly effective against clustered Skeletal Warriors in the Tomb of the Ancients.
    • Pull & Pierce: Command Trax to use his Grapple Hook to pull a distant enemy, such as a Flying Harpy, close. As they are pulled, switch to your bow and land a critical headshot or a powerful melee attack as they land.
    • Elemental Synergy: If Sayla applies a Frost status effect with her ranged attacks, switch to a weapon with a Fire Enchantment to trigger a Shatter combo, dealing bonus damage to frozen foes.
    • Aggro & Flank: Have Dellingr use his Taunt ability to draw the attention of a powerful enemy, like a Desert Guardian. While the enemy is focused on Dellingr, position yourself to attack their vulnerable back or flanks with heavy attacks.
  • Maximizing Effectiveness: Pay attention to your follower's cooldowns and energy. Use their abilities strategically, not just whenever they're available. Some abilities are best saved for specific enemy types or critical moments in a fight.

Environmental Hazards: Turn the Battlefield Against Your Foes

The environments in Asgard's Wrath 2 are not just backdrops; they are dynamic elements that can be weaponized against your enemies. Awareness and quick thinking can turn a perilous situation into a tactical advantage.

  • Exploiting Ledges and Pits: Many areas, particularly in the Celestial Realm and the Underworld Caverns, feature dangerous drops. Use your shield bash, heavy attacks, or even certain follower abilities (like Trax's Charge) to knock enemies into these hazards for instant kills or significant fall damage. This is especially effective against large, slow enemies like Stone Golems.
  • Triggering Traps: Keep an eye out for environmental traps. These can include:
    • Spike Traps: Found in ancient ruins, these can be activated by pressure plates or by hitting a specific mechanism. Lure enemies onto them.
    • Falling Rocks/Debris: In unstable caverns, look for cracked ceilings or precarious rock formations. A well-aimed ranged attack or a powerful melee strike can bring them down on unsuspecting foes.
    • Explosive Barrels/Crystals: Common in enemy encampments or magical areas. Hit them with a ranged attack to detonate them, dealing area-of-effect damage and often applying status effects.
  • Utilizing Elemental Sources: Some environments feature pools of lava, icy surfaces, or electrical conduits. Knocking enemies into these can apply powerful status effects or deal continuous damage. For instance, pushing a Fire Elemental into a pool of water can temporarily douse its flames, making it vulnerable.
  • Strategic Positioning: Always be aware of your surroundings. Positioning yourself near a hazard can give you an escape route or an opportunity to push enemies into danger.

Dynamic Weapon Switching: Adapt and Overcome

Asgard's Wrath 2 features a diverse arsenal, and the ability to seamlessly switch between your equipped weapons mid-combat is a cornerstone of advanced play. Each weapon type excels in different situations, and knowing when to swap can turn the tide of battle.

  • How to Switch: You can typically equip two primary weapons and a shield, along with your bow. Quick-switching between your primary weapons is done via a dedicated button or gesture, allowing for fluid transitions.
  • Weapon Type Advantages:
    • Swords: Fast attacks, good for quick combos and parrying. Ideal for agile enemies or when you need to maintain constant pressure.
    • Axes: Balanced damage and speed, often with good crowd-control potential. Versatile for most situations.
    • Hammers/Maces: Slow, heavy attacks that deal massive damage and are excellent for breaking armor or stunning enemies. Perfect for armored foes like Iron-Clad Berserkers or large, slow targets.
    • Bows: Ranged damage, essential for flying enemies, targeting weak points from a distance, or triggering environmental hazards. Crucial for dealing with Flying Scarabs or archers on elevated platforms.
    • Shield: Defensive utility, parrying, and shield bashing. Can interrupt enemy attacks and create openings.
  • Strategic Switching Examples:
    • Armor Break & Finish: Encounter an Armored Knight. Start with your hammer to quickly break their armor. Once the armor is shattered, switch to your sword for faster, more precise strikes against their now-vulnerable body.
    • Crowd Control & Ranged Cleanup: You're surrounded by a group of Ghouls. Use your axe's wide swings to clear the immediate area. As some retreat or are knocked back, quickly switch to your bow to pick off stragglers or flying enemies that enter the fray.
    • Boss Phase Adaptation: During the fight with Jormungandr, you might need your bow to target weak points on its head during one phase, then switch to your hammer for heavy attacks against its body when it's grounded in another.
    • Parry & Counter: Use your shield to Perfect Parry an incoming attack, then immediately switch to your heaviest weapon (hammer or axe) to capitalize on the stun window with a powerful follow-up.
  • Practice Makes Perfect: Spend time in less challenging encounters practicing your weapon switches. The goal is to make these transitions feel natural and instantaneous, allowing you to react to any threat without hesitation.
